Nearing the end of its run and in anticipation of the release of the fiberglass model to replace it, FM issued their last small supply of diecast metal cars but inadvertently put whitewall tires on them. Since this is the only difference between models and it was meant to replicate the stripped-to-the-bone street runner in 1:1 fashion, we know this as an error. It is easy to counterfeit this issue. The tires from 56, 58, 59 or even 60 FM Corvettes will fit. One possible way, however, to know if it is genuine, is to spin the front tires. They should turn freely. There are two brake air ducts underneath the car that will rub if the tires have been replaced revealing it as a fraud. If the tires touch, that's ok, but they should be able to turn relatively freely. Issue price was $90. (02/25/2003) |
